Tony Craig

Returned to The Den on a permanent basis during the summer of 2008, having left for Crystal Palace 12 months previously.
The popular left back, who can also operate as a central defender, won Millwall's Young Player of the Year award just prior to moving across South London after making more than 80 senior appearances for The Lions.
Kenny Jackett brought him back to SE16 on loan in March of 2008, and so impressed was the Lions boss, that he bided his time before landing Craig on a three-year deal.
He went on to take over captain's duties from Paul Robinson in the latter's absence, but once Robbo returned to action during the 2009/10, TC remained as vocal as ever on the field of play. Last season proved to be one of sheer joy - and pain - for the local lad.
The pain came in the shape of an horrendous facial injury sustained during the home game against Wycombe Wanderers when he ended up with a fractured cheekbone and eye socket. Defying the medics, he was back playing with a special 'Zorro' type protective mask after just a six-game absence.
A foot injury at Huddersfield in April looked to have ruled him out for the rest of the season, but once again he made a miraculous recovery and was back in action in the blink of an eye.
The injury jinx struck for a third time in the Play-Off final at Wembley with another foot injury forcing him off during the first-half. But despite being in a special airboot and on crutches, TC showed the type of determination at the end of the game that epitomises his character, hobbling up the stairs at Wembley to pick up his winners' medal at the final whistle!
Now back in training, he is pencilling in a return to first team football early in the 2010/11 campaign.
